Traditionelle Speichersysteme Filesystem Inseln und fragmentierte Nutzungsgrade
Utilization rates vary across islands QOS headroom Performance considerations = Net Utilization 50% - 65% FlexVol (Max 16TB) Aggregate (Max 16TB) Most organizations have islands of file servers or NAS devices that are carved up as network shares. As the number of employees and The data they crete grows, so does the challenge of managing these islands. The most common complaint from IT adminstrators include Load balancing (perf & capacity) across these islands, moving users, migrating data, and upgrading hardware and software. RAID - DP The most common complaint from IT administrators include load balancing (perf & capacity) across these islands, moving users, migrating data, and upgrading hardware and software. ~Source: IDC 2008 File Systems Define the Future for Managing Storage

FlexProtect Data Protection
New N+2:1 FlexProtect Overview File-level, software-based data protection Industry leading reliability & data protection (millions of years MTTDL) Real-time, flexible policy that can be set at the cluster, directory & file level New, More Efficient FlexProtect Policy = N+2:1 New N+2:1 = Withstand one node failure and two drive failures Tradeoff node failure (uncommon) for drive failures (more common) Maximizes storage utilization while not sacrificing data protection No other storage vendor has this flexibility and efficiency Isilon NL Cluster N+2 New N+2:1 % Overhead Reduction Usable TB Improvement # 0f Nodes Overhead Usable 10 20% 288 TB 11% 324TB 45% 12.5%

Broad Institute BACKGROUND challenge solution
Broad Institute of MIT and Harvard is one of the world’s leading genomics and biomedical research institutes “ With Isilon IQ, we’ve been able to grow a single file system to nearly a petabyte in less than a year, while still maintaining the data throughput necessary to power our workflow and advance our research.” ─ Matthew Trunnell, Manager of Research Computing at the Broad Institute challenge Needed massive scalability: Recent flurry of next-generation DNA sequencing technologies has caused intense performance and capacity demands—beyond those typical of traditional storage systems Instruments generate terabytes per day of data to be analyzed, meaning an unprecedented amount of data needs to be stored and managed just so researchers can do their jobs solution With Isilon IQ, Broad has accelerated its high-performance workflow while also supporting a five-fold increase in the volume of genomic data that can be analyzed and stored—without adding support staff Researchers can devote precious time and resources into groundbreaking biomedical research Isilon solution includes 5 Isilon IQ 9000i nodes; 5 Isilon EX extension nodes; 45 Isilon IQ X-series nodes; and 45 Isilon EX12000 extension nodes ISILON IQ POWERS DATA STORAGE FOR NEXT-GENERATION DNA SEQUENCING The Broad Institute of MIT and Harvard Deploys Isilon Clustered Storage to Manage Rapid Genomic Data Expansion, Enabling Five-Fold Data Growth SEATTLE, WA — September 15, 2008 — Isilon® Systems (NASDAQ: ISLN), the leader in clustered storage, today announced that the Broad Institute of MIT and Harvard, one of the world’s leading genomics and biomedical research institutes, has deployed Isilon IQ clustered storage to streamline mission-critical data access and utilization in its next-generation DNA sequencing workflow. With Isilon IQ, the Broad Institute has accelerated its high-performance workflow while also supporting a five-fold increase in the volume of genomic data that can be analyzed and stored, enabling researchers to devote precious time and resources into groundbreaking biomedical research. “Applications of next-generation DNA sequencing at the Broad Institute and elsewhere require an unprecedented amount of data to be stored and managed in a high-performance research and bioinformatics pipeline,” said Matthew Trunnell, Manager of Research Computing at the Broad Institute. “With Isilon IQ, we’ve been able to grow a single file system to nearly a Petabyte in less than a year, while still maintaining the data throughput necessary to power our workflow and advance our research.” The data growth and performance needs of DNA sequencing have changed rapidly and unexpectedly, driven by a recent flurry of next-generation technologies. To maintain research productivity, traditional storage systems need to adapt to meet the intense performance and capacity demands of these new technologies. Without a unified and flexible storage repository, institutions may be forced to spread their data across multiple, disparate silos of information, creating unnecessary barriers to data access and analysis. Deploying Isilon IQ, with its OneFS® operating system software, enables researchers to unify their genomic data into a single, high-performance, highly scalable shared pool of data. Today, instruments at the Broad Institute generate terabytes per day of DNA sequence and related data, which must then be analyzed. Using Isilon clustered storage, this data can be directly stored and analyzed, enabling the Institute’s scientists to access, process and store genomic data from one, easily accessible and highly reliable central storage repository. “In today’s next-generation genomic sequencing research, the rate at which data is created and analyzed can accelerate by the month – or by the day. To stay ahead of data growth and maximize the value of this truly mission-critical information, research institutions must be able to efficiently store, access and analyze this data at an unprecedented rate,” said Steve Fitz, Senior Vice President, Global Field Operations, Isilon Systems. “The Broad Institute is at the leading-edge of using the latest advances in both genomic sequencing technology and clustered storage to create the biomedical breakthroughs that can transform medicine as we know it.” Powered by OneFS, Isilon IQ X-Series delivers the industry's first single file system that unifies and provides instant and ubiquitous access to the rapidly growing stores of file-based data, setting the standard for scale out file storage. NBC Universal BACKGROUND challenge solution
“ Isilon IQ is uniquely architected to address the business needs of NBC Universal, enabling us to transform our digital media assets into new breakthroughs in the creation, management and delivery of high-quality programming.” ─ David Evans, Director, Storage Solutions, Global Operations, NBC Universal World’s leading media and entertainment company with media properties spanning entertainment TV and production, movies news and sports Move to high-definition TV and new media delivery models drive requirements to archive and instantly access vast stores of digital media in multiple formats challenge Create a single lane of storage for all digital content – one storage provider for entire lane Manage, store and access vast and rapidly growing archives of media programming for entertainment TV and production, movies, news and sports solution Press Release Isilon Systems Announces Multi-Year Agreement With NBC Universal NBC Universal Deploys Isilon IQ to Archive and Access Growing Stores of Digital Media During Period of Profound Change in Media and Entertainment Industry NBC Deploys Isilon IQ as Part of Its Broadcast Infrastructure for the 2008 Olympic Games SEATTLE, WA - April 16, Isilon® Systems (Nasdaq: ISLN), the leader in clustered storage, today announced that NBC Universal, one of the world's leading media and entertainment companies, has chosen Isilon IQ to archive and access growing stores of media programming including entertainment TV and production, movies, news, and sports. Under the multi-year agreement with Isilon, NBC Universal plans to deploy multiple Petabytes of Isilon IQ clustered storage in its main production and broadcast operations to maximize the value of their media assets across NBC Universal's media properties. Isilon also announced today that NBC is deploying Isilon IQ to facilitate its coverage of the 2008 Olympic Games in Beijing. Additionally, Isilon announced today that NBC Olympics Vice President of Information Technology, Craig Lau, will deliver a main stage address at Storage Networking World (SNW) entitled, "Delivering the Unprecedented: How NBC Uses Clustered Storage To Help Transform Its Broadcast Coverage of the Olympic Games." NBC used Isilon IQ to create new breakthroughs in its coverage of the 2004 Olympic Games in Athens and the 2006 Olympic Winter Games in Torino. "With the rapid move to digital media and broadband connections, the broadcast industry has forever changed," said David Evans, Director, Storage Solutions, Global Operations NBC Universal. "This shift in the broadcast paradigm - multiple distribution channels, formats, and consumption models - has resulted in massive increases in the amount and importance of archived media. It is not enough to simply store this content; it must also be always on-line and instantly accessible. Isilon IQ is uniquely architected to address the business needs of NBC Universal, enabling us to transform our digital media assets into new breakthroughs in the creation, management and delivery of high-quality programming." Isilon is being deployed to complement and, in some cases, replace traditional tape based technology which allows for faster access times and increased reliability. With major deployments of Isilon IQ, NBC Universal's multiple broadcast and production units now have instant access to the vast libraries of media programming regardless of physical location, enabling NBC Universal to enhance live broadcasts or create new breakthroughs in the delivery of programming through NBC Universal's multiple media distribution networks. Next summer in Beijing, NBC is primed to deliver the first-ever television broadcast of the Olympic Games available completely in High Definition. Following NBC's successful use of Isilon IQ for the 2004 Olympic Games in Athens and the 2006 Olympic Winter Games in Torino, NBC is storing the majority of the 2008 Beijing Games proxy and broadband content on Isilon clustered storage, providing NBC producers with unprecedented, highly reliable access to critical content for rapid review, identification and selection operations necessary to quickly produce and deliver groundbreaking coverage of Beijing Olympics in the United States. "The Olympic Games are the single biggest event on earth, necessitating coverage that effectively captures the passion and unscripted drama of the Olympics to our millions of viewers," said Craig Lau, VP of Information Technology, NBC Olympics. "In order to deliver the unprecedented coverage of the Beijing Olympics, we need a storage solution that can reliably deliver unparalleled access to content for our broadcast team, both on-site in Beijing and at our multiple broadcast centers in the United States. Having used Isilon IQ for each of the past two Olympic Games, we know it will once again provide all we need to successfully execute our broadcast in Beijing." Turner Studios BACKGROUND challenge solution
Worth Noting: Isilon clustered storage helped Turner Studies condense about five years of encoding work into two years. The in-house production facility of Turner Broadcasting System, Inc., a Time Warner company One of multiple divisions of Turner Broadcasting using Isilon challenge An increasing volume of difficult-to-manage and hard-to- access media content slowed down delivery to market of digital and high-definition television programming and products solution Turner Studios connected its Apple Final Cut Pro systems directly to Isilon IQ to create a high-performance, active editing system By playing the material directly off the Isilon system, Turner Studios has created a much more efficient editorial workflow Almost 600 TB capacity on Isilon storage TURNER STUDIOS TRANSFORMS MEDIA PRODUCTION AND DISTRIBUTION WITH ISILON IQ Central Storage System Enables Rapid Digital Media Production for TV and Entertainment Powerhouse; Isilon IQ Combines with Apple Final Cut Pro To Create High Performance Active Editing System for High-Definition Broadcast Programming SEATTLE, WA — September 15, 2008 — Isilon® Systems (NASDAQ: ISLN), the leader in clustered storage, today announced that Turner Studios, the in-house production facility of Turner Broadcasting System, Inc., a Time Warner company, has deployed Isilon IQ clustered storage as one of its primary media repositories. By unifying its massive stores of media programming onto a single, high-performance, highly scalable, shared pool of Isilon clustered storage, Turner Studios can easily manage and quickly access its digital media content to create television programs and other media. Turner Studios is among multiple divisions of Turner Broadcasting using Isilon IQ to store and access a broad range of file-based data. Turner Studios has connected its Apple Final Cut Pro systems directly to Isilon IQ to create an active editorial system, making its HD media immediately accessible and eliminating the need to transfer files before editing. By playing the material directly off the Isilon system, Turner Studios has created a more efficient editorial workflow. Turner Studios’s Digital Media Group deployed Isilon clustered storage to condense about five years of encoding work into two years, and is using it to author DVDs and create new products for services like Apple iTunes, Microsoft Xbox or Joost. “Modern enterprises face the challenge of managing and leveraging massive amounts of data to maintain a competitive advantage,” said Steve Fitz, Senior Vice President of Worldwide Field Operations, Isilon Systems. “Media companies, particularly, recognize that success in today’s digital age hinges on an organization’s ability to harness data in meaningful ways to move the business forward. Isilon clustered storage was specifically designed to empower this ability and enable these companies to significantly decrease time-to-market.” Prior to Isilon, Turner Studios managed its ever-increasing volume of media content with several shared Direct Attached Storage (DAS) systems. Editors and clients used different systems using different methods – from different workstations – in order to access media content. With a rapidly growing television business, an expanding list of broadband projects and an increase in high-definition programming, expanding their storage capacity was important.
